#2db6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2db6ce is composed of 17.6% red, 71.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 11.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 188.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#2db6ce color hex could be obtained by blending #5affff with #006d9d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#2db6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2db6ce has RGB values of R:45, G:182,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 2995918.

Shades and Tints of #2db6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b0d is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2db6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8081 is the less saturated color, while #06d1f5 is the most saturated one.
